    Alex K.

    I can go on and on about this place. It's our go to whenever we're in the desert. Service is always amazing and the details of everything, that's why we're always back.... It's not a big property but is packed with everything. About 16 rooms. I love that they'll text you to see what your arrival time will be. It's nice in a sense that they see what they can do to accommodate your room availability. If it isn't ready, you're always welcome to come and utilize the property and pool until it's ready. Your luggage can be held while you relax. Another amazing perks about this place, they have a 24 hour cantina that offers soda, water, Starbucks coffee, cookies, popcorn, fruit and so on. Ice maker is there as well. A mini snack shop/kitchen. Not only that, continental breakfast every morning between a certain time. Take it to your room, have it by the pool or tables. Fresh fruit salad, parfait, croissant, bagels, fruits, muffins, eggs and different protein choices that's different each day. Also the selection of juices. During the weekend, there's the mimosas and champagne cart that's self serve. The perks to this place. Lounges are always nice. Very thick and plush. Umbrellas are scattered throughout the pool area. To top things off, they come around with popsicle both with and without alcohol. Yumm when it's hot. And cold eucalyptus towels for your face. If that isn't amazing service. Lunch is also included. Just place your order by a certain time and it's delivered around 12:30. The rooms are all pretty big, nice king sized bed which is quite comfortable. A nice modern and mid century feel to it. Rooms does have a separate seating area and well as a workspace. Nice plush bathrrobes are also in the room as well as a fridge. Service is always excellent. The staff are always so friendly and welcoming. Even the guest, everyone becomes friends during the stay. Will be back again soon.

    William K.

    Our stay at Descanso Resort exceeded all expectations. On our way Charles sent us a welcoming text message, he was responsive in answering my questions about an EV charging station (which they have) and he met us at the gate upon our arrival. He gave us a tour of the property and showed us to our room. Upon entering we found a tin of Brandini's Toffee, candle and birthday card to celebrate my partner's birthday (thank you Charles)! The saline pool is maintained at 90 degrees and the jacuzzi is warm and relaxing. The guests were all friendly and low-key and a continental breakfast is provided every morning at 8:00 a.m. (thank you Bob and Vlad) and a lunch from Aspen Bakery at 12:30 p.m. (pre-ordered by 11:00 a.m.) and wine time is Thur-Sat at 4:00 p.m. (thank you Dustin) and mimosas are served every Sunday morning. We've stayed at Santiago (pre-pandemic) and plan to check out Twin Palms, but Descanso is definitely our speed (relaxed, quiet, mature, and comfortable "Au Naturel")

    GRAND HYATT INDIAN WELLS RESORT & VILLAS @ INDIAN WELLS…read more Parking is $35 a day for self parking, which adds up over a few nights. There's plenty of space in the lot so you're never circling for a spot, but just be aware of the cost going in. The lobby is actually pretty small for a resort this size, which surprised me. There's a Starbucks right inside though, which was clutch in the mornings. The property is spread out, so they have golf carts running around to shuttle you between buildings, which is a nice touch if you don't feel like walking. I stayed in a king room and it was clean and comfortable with a nice patio. Friends of ours were in one of the villas and those were really nice, way more space if you're traveling with a group. Rooms here run around $500 a night and up depending on the season, so it's not a cheap stay. The pools are the main draw, they have nine of them plus HyTides waterpark with the slides and lazy river. Fair warning, they were absolutely packed with kids when we went. This is very much a family resort more than an adults getaway. There is an adults only Oasis pool if you want somewhere quieter, which I'd recommend if you're not traveling with kids. Overall a solid stay, just go in knowing what kind of place it is.
